Crude chemical geology and geology is an cross-disciplinary area that integrates concepts from geoscience, chem, and natural philosophy to understand the genesis, migration, and concentration of petroleum fluids in the subterranean. This field of study is essential for the prospecting and recovery of petroleum and natural gas, as it assists to recognize possible oil bearing structures, forecast pool attributes, and maximize excavation and production operations.
